(March 17) On Friday, August 6, 2021, the Aurora Police Department received a report pertaining to allegations of child exploitation involving Darnell Ward (DOB: 02/21/1978). The investigation confirmed the allegations of the original victim and investigators learned of two other additional victims.

The investigation determined that Ward occasionally was a parent spectator at Overland High School girls’ basketball games and would help record scores for the game. However, he was not an official volunteer. It is believed Ward also has helped with sporting events in the Denver Metro area schools. Based on Ward’s history and past allegations, Investigators believe there are additional victims who have been victimized by Ward and have not yet reported it.

On Wednesday, March 9, 2022, Ward was arrested for charges related to Child Exploitation and Sexual Assault in Phoenix, Arizona. Since his arrest, Ward has been extradited to Colorado. The 18th Judicial District Attorney’s Office will be prosecuting this case, and any additional media inquiries should be directed there.

Our Victim Services Unit is working closely with the families to offer support and help them work through this difficult event.

If there are any additional victims who are wishing to report to the police, they are asked to call Police Dispatch at (303) 627-3100 immediately. Anyone with additional information about this incident is encouraged to call the Internet Crimes Against Children at 303.739.6711.
